What are the must-see historical places and other sights in Quinte West?
Quinte West is notable for landmarks like Trenton Clock Tower. Cultural venues include National Air Force Museum of Canada, Old Church Theatre, and Trent Port Museum. A couple of additional sights to add to your agenda are Canadian Forces Base Trenton and Barcovan Golf Club.
What is a historic hotel like in Quinte West?
When you book a historic hotel, you'll sleep someplace that has an officially recognized national historic designation. A palace, castle, grand home or even an old police station, pub, lodge, or skyscraper can be considered a historic hotel as long as it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are typically found in the guestrooms or communal spaces of historic hotels in Quinte West, bringing the history to life.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is more common in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of historic hotels are generally the most significant aspect. For a heritage hotel, mainly, it's cultural value and how it shaped the community.
